加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 综合聚焦 > 服务器 > 安全 > 正文

unix – 环境变量中的SSH密钥

发布时间:2020-12-16 01:12:23 所属栏目:安全 来源:网络整理
导读:所以我正在建立一个非常棒的hubot设置,它将通过一个免费的heroku nodejs应用程序自动将代码从 github部署到heroku.我无法在AWS上正确检查回购.我在远程盒子上创建了SSH密钥,让它们工作并验证它.然后,我将它们添加为Heroku环境变量,如下所示: ~$heroku confi
所以我正在建立一个非常棒的hubot设置,它将通过一个免费的heroku nodejs应用程序自动将代码从 github部署到heroku.我无法在AWS上正确检查回购.我在远程盒子上创建了SSH密钥,让它们工作并验证它.然后,我将它们添加为Heroku环境变量,如下所示:
~$heroku config:add PRIVATE_KEY="...
aoijsdfasoidjfasodijfasodifjaodsifjasdofija"

然后我尝试将公钥和私钥回显到.ssh / id_rsa中的正常位置,但是他们问我一个密码,我没有设置,并且总是失败.

知道如何成功地将密钥写入环境变量吗?我认为这与没有正确显示的换行符有关.

啊!当然.

如果你回显“$VAR”,它会保留其格式.立即更新我的脚本.

(我整天都在做这件事.谢谢橡皮鸭.)

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读